Hi, does anyone know how much the cabin prices are on the Portsmouth Caen ferry please?
I can see that the return cost for a 7 day holiday is £190 but don’t know the cabin cost.
We did this route several years ago and booked a cabin on the overnight on the way out, and picked up a day cabin for £25 on the way back for us to recharge in ��
If anyone knows the cost, or the place to find it that would be great, thanks.
Ps could also do with knowing the charge for a recliner chair overnight too if anyone knows, thanks.
Hi, does anyone know how much the cabin prices are on the Portsmouth Caen ferry please?
The absolute cheapest overnight cabins are £55, or at least they were a couple of years ago when I looked into it. Very much days & availability dependent, I would budget up to £150 depending on when you are going (on top of the price of the crossing).
You could always do a dummy run through booking on the Brittany Ferries website to get an idea.
